A Brief Overview
Provides comprehensive evaluation and treatment of sleep disorders.
This may involve polysommography, diagnostic and therapeutic
services or patient care and education. The Sleep Lab Technologist
is responsible for sleep studies and communicating with the patient
and physicians.
